Cantaloupe Popsicles The Two Bite Club

Instructions. Puree the cantaloupe in a blender and set aside. Combine the whipping cream and sugar in a saucepan and stir over low heat until the sugar is dissolved (should only take a couple of minutes). Remove from heat and stir in the pureed cantaloupe. Pour into popsicle molds and freeze until firm.

Simple GardenFresh Popsicles Recipe Cantaloupe popsicle recipes

Instructions. In a blender puree the cantaloupe, honey, vanilla extract, and cream mix until smooth. 3 cups cubed cantaloupe, 2 cup heavy cream, 2 tbsp vanilla extract, ½ cup honey. Pour into popsicle molds and freeze until firm. Enjoy!
